Transaction 3b4ee16ffc102eb4588352783871dcf03f79fcb06e07efa60198b5a4e2bfa6f6
1 Input
1 Output
-
3b4ee16ffc102eb4588352783871dcf03f79fcb06e07efa60198b5a4e2bfa6f6:0
- value
- 321453
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12bb66f6f5698d996c13f48757e1969e56621509 OP_EQUAL
- address
- 33Q4avuZ572cyozfWh2DHCNAZzaVLCD1Wb